On Thu, Jun 20, 2013 at 10:00 PM, Geremy Condra <gcondra@xxxxxxxxxx> wrote:
> With this change dm-verity errors will cause uevents to be
> sent to userspace, notifying it that an error has occurred
> and potentially triggering recovery actions.
>
> Signed-off-by: Geremy Condra <gcondra@xxxxxxxxxx>
> ---
> Changelog since v1:
> - Removed the DM_VERITY_ERROR_NOTIFY config option
